Company Overview
U.S. Bancorp is a diversified financial services holding company headquartered in Minneapolis, Minnesota, and the parent company of U.S. Bank National Association. The company operates primarily in the banking and financial services industries, offering consumer banking, commercial banking, payments services, wealth management, trust services, and capital markets products. It is one of the largest banking institutions in the United States by assets and maintains a broad customer base that includes individuals, small businesses, corporations, institutional clients, and government entities. Its primary revenue drivers include net interest income from lending activities, fee-based income from payment processing and trust services, and treasury and corporate banking operations.
The company traces its roots to the late 19th century through predecessor banks in the Midwestern United States. Modern U.S. Bancorp was formed through a series of mergers, including the 1998 merger between First Bank System and U.S. Bancorp of Oregon, after which the combined company adopted the U.S. Bancorp name. Over time, the company expanded nationally through acquisitions and organic growth, developing significant scale in regional banking and payment services. Industry analysts and regulatory filings have consistently identified the company’s relatively conservative credit culture, diversified fee income base, and operational efficiency as important competitive characteristics.
